We have a RCP jobs which is connecting to multiple source systems. We have created the Parameterset in the job and the values are hardcoded(DSN,USER,PASSWORD etc).
It has been decided to remove the hardcoded values from the parameterset.
We tried few mentioned setps
Defined the environment variables as
$Tuser=Tax
$Ruser=Wax
Created Parameter Set
Variable name =Username
Values
t1 $Tuser
t2 $Ruser
But when I am reading the values in my job and passing t1/t2 of parameterset, I am getting the output as $Tuser or $Ruser instead of Tax and Wax..
Please suggest
